az dt

Not

Bu başvuru, Azure CLI (sürüm 2.30.0 veya üzeri) için azure-iot uzantısının bir parçasıdır. Uzantı, bir az dt komutunu ilk kez çalıştırdığınızda otomatik olarak yüklenir. Uzantılar hakkında daha fazla bilgi edinin.

Altyapı & Azure Digital Twins çözümlerini yönetin.

Komutlar

az dt create

Digital Twins örneği oluşturun veya güncelleştirin.

az dt data-history

Veri geçmişini yönetme ve yapılandırma.

az dt data-history connection

Veri geçmişi bağlantılarını yönetin ve yapılandırın.

az dt data-history connection create

Digital Twins örneğiyle desteklenen kaynaklar arasında veri geçmişi bağlantısı oluşturur.

az dt data-history connection create adx

Digital Twins örneğiyle Azure Veri Gezgini veritabanı arasında veri geçmişi bağlantısı oluşturur. Önceden oluşturulmuş Azure Veri Gezgini ve Olay Hub'ı kaynakları gerektirir.

az dt data-history connection delete

Digital Twins örneğinde yapılandırılmış bir veri geçmişi bağlantısını silin.

az dt data-history connection list

Digital Twins örneğinde yapılandırılan tüm veri geçmişi bağlantılarını listeleyin.

az dt data-history connection show

Digital Twins örneğinde yapılandırılan veri geçmişi bağlantısının ayrıntılarını gösterin.

az dt data-history connection wait

Veri geçmişi bağlantısındaki bir işlemin tamamlanmasını bekleyin.

az dt delete

Var olan bir Digital Twins örneğini silin.

az dt endpoint

Digital Twins örnek uç noktalarını yönetin ve yapılandırın.

az dt endpoint create

Digital Twins örneğine çıkış uç noktaları ekleyin.

az dt endpoint create eventgrid

Digital Twins örneğine EventGrid Konu uç noktası ekler. Önceden oluşturulmuş kaynak gerektirir.

az dt endpoint create eventhub

Digital Twins örneğine bir EventHub uç noktası ekler. Önceden oluşturulmuş kaynak gerektirir. Kimlik tabanlı uç nokta tümleştirmesini desteklemek için örnek yönetilen kimlikle oluşturulmalıdır.

az dt endpoint create servicebus

Bir Digital Twins örneğine ServiceBus Konu uç noktası ekler. Önceden oluşturulmuş kaynak gerektirir. Kimlik tabanlı uç nokta tümleştirmesini desteklemek için örnek yönetilen kimlikle oluşturulmalıdır.

az dt endpoint delete

Digital Twins örneğinden bir uç noktayı kaldırma.

az dt endpoint list

Digital Twins örneğinde yapılandırılan tüm çıkış uç noktalarını listeleyin.

az dt endpoint show

Digital Twins örneğinde yapılandırılmış bir uç noktanın ayrıntılarını gösterir.

az dt endpoint wait

Uç nokta işlemi tamamlanıncaya kadar bekleyin.

az dt job

Dijital ikiz örneği için işleri yönetme ve yapılandırma.

az dt job import

Model, ikiz ve ilişki verilerini dijital ikiz örneğine aktarmak için işleri yönetin ve yapılandırın.

az dt job import create

Dijital ikiz örneğinde veri içeri aktarma işi oluşturma ve yürütme.

az dt job import delete

Dijital ikiz örneğinde yürütülen bir veri içeri aktarma işini silin.

az dt job import list

Bir dijital ikiz örneğinde yürütülen tüm veri içeri aktarma işlerini listeleyin.

az dt job import show

Dijital ikizler örneğinde yürütülen bir veri içeri aktarma işinin ayrıntılarını gösterin.

az dt list

Digital Twins örneklerinin koleksiyonunu aboneliğe veya kaynak grubuna göre listeleyin.

az dt model

Digital Twins örneğinde DTDL modellerini ve tanımlarını yönetme.

az dt model create

Bir veya daha fazla modeli karşıya yükler. Herhangi bir hata oluştuğunda hiçbir model karşıya yüklenmez.

az dt model delete

Modeli silme. Bir model yalnızca başka hiçbir model başvuruda bulunmadığında silinebilir.

az dt model delete-all

Digital Twins örneğindeki tüm modelleri silin. İkiz yapılandırmaları etkilenmez ancak model tanımları olmadan bozulabilir.

az dt model list

Model meta verilerini, tanımlarını ve bağımlılıklarını listeleyin.

az dt model show

Hedef modeli veya model tanımını alma.

az dt model update

Modelin meta verilerini Güncelleştirmeler. Şu anda bir model yalnızca kullanımdan kaldırılabilir.

az dt network

Özel bağlantılar ve uç nokta bağlantıları dahil olmak üzere Digital Twins ağ yapılandırmasını yönetin.

az dt network private-endpoint

Digital Twins örneği özel uç noktalarını yönetme.

az dt network private-endpoint connection

Digital Twins örneği özel uç nokta bağlantılarını yönetin.

az dt network private-endpoint connection delete

Digital Twins örneğiyle ilişkili özel uç nokta bağlantısını silin.

az dt network private-endpoint connection list

Digital Twins örneğiyle ilişkili özel uç nokta bağlantılarını listeleyin.

az dt network private-endpoint connection set

Digital Twins örneğiyle ilişkili özel uç nokta bağlantısının durumunu ayarlayın.

az dt network private-endpoint connection show

Digital Twins örneğiyle ilişkilendirilmiş bir özel uç nokta bağlantısı gösterin.

az dt network private-endpoint connection wait

Özel uç nokta bağlantısındaki bir işlemin tamamlanmasını bekleyin.

az dt network private-link

Digital Twins örneği özel bağlantı işlemlerini yönetin.

az dt network private-link list

Digital Twins örneğiyle ilişkili özel bağlantıları listeleyin.

az dt network private-link show

Örnekle ilişkilendirilmiş bir özel bağlantı gösterin.

az dt reset

İlişkili varlıkları silerek mevcut Digital Twins örneğini sıfırlayın. Şu anda yalnızca modelleri ve ikizleri silmeyi desteklemektedir.

az dt role-assignment

Digital Twins örneği için RBAC rol atamalarını yönetme.

az dt role-assignment create

Digital Twins örneğine karşı bir role kullanıcı, grup veya hizmet sorumlusu atayın.

az dt role-assignment delete

Digital Twins örneğinden kullanıcı, grup veya hizmet sorumlusu rol atamasını kaldırın.

az dt role-assignment list

Digital Twins örneğinin mevcut rol atamalarını listeleme.

az dt route

Olay yollarını yönetin ve yapılandırın.

az dt route create

Digital Twins örneğine bir olay yolu ekleyin.

az dt route delete

Digital Twins örneğinden olay rotasını kaldırma.

az dt route list

Digital Twins örneğinin yapılandırılmış olay yollarını listeleyin.

az dt route show

Digital Twins örneğinde yapılandırılmış bir olay yolunun ayrıntılarını gösterin.

az dt show

Mevcut bir Digital Twins örneğini gösterme.

az dt twin

Digital Twins örneğinin dijital ikizlerini yönetme ve yapılandırma.

az dt twin component

Digital Twins örneğinin dijital ikiz bileşenlerini gösterin ve güncelleştirin.

az dt twin component show

Dijital ikiz bileşeninin ayrıntılarını gösterin.

az dt twin component update

JSON düzeltme eki belirtimi aracılığıyla bir dijital ikiz bileşenini güncelleştirin.

az dt twin create

Bir örnekte dijital ikiz oluşturma.

az dt twin delete

Dijital ikizi kaldırın. Bu ikize başvuran tüm ilişkiler zaten silinmiş olmalıdır.

az dt twin delete-all

Bir Digital Twins örneğindeki tüm dijital ikizleri siler ve bu ikizlerin tüm ilişkileri de buna dahildir.

az dt twin query

Örneğin dijital ikizlerini sorgulama. İlişkilerin çapraz geçiş yapmasına ve özellik değerlerine göre filtrelenmesine izin verir.

az dt twin relationship

Digital Twins örneğinin dijital ikiz ilişkilerini yönetin ve yapılandırın.

az dt twin relationship create

Kaynak ve hedef dijital ikizler arasında bir ilişki oluşturun.

az dt twin relationship delete

Digital Twins örneğindeki dijital ikiz ilişkisini silme.

az dt twin relationship delete-all

Gelen ilişkiler de dahil olmak üzere bir Digital Twins örneği içindeki tüm dijital ikiz ilişkilerini siler.

az dt twin relationship list

Dijital ikizin ilişkilerini listeleme.

az dt twin relationship show

Dijital ikiz ilişkisinin ayrıntılarını gösterme.

az dt twin relationship update

JSON düzeltme eki belirtimi aracılığıyla iki dijital ikiz arasındaki ilişkinin özelliklerini Güncelleştirmeler.

az dt twin show

Dijital ikizin ayrıntılarını gösterin.

az dt twin telemetry

Digital Twins örneğinin olay yollarını ve uç noktalarını test edin ve doğrulayın.

az dt twin telemetry send

Dijital ikiz adına telemetri gönderir. Bileşen yolu sağlanmışsa, yayılan telemetri bileşen adınadır.

az dt twin update

JSON düzeltme eki belirtimi aracılığıyla örnek dijital ikizini güncelleştirin.

az dt wait

Digital Twins örneğindeki bir işlem tamamlanana kadar bekleyin.

az dt create

Digital Twins örneği oluşturun veya güncelleştirin.

az dt create --dt-name
             --resource-group
             [--assign-identity {false, true}]
             [--location]
             [--no-wait]
             [--pna {Disabled, Enabled}]
             [--role]
             [--scopes]
             [--tags]

Örnekler

Kaynak grubu konumunu kullanarak hedef kaynak grubunda örnek oluşturun.

az dt create -n {instance_name} -g {resouce_group}

Belirtilen konum ve etiketlerle hedef kaynak grubunda örnek oluşturun.

az dt create -n {instance_name} -g {resouce_group} -l westus --tags a=b c=d

Sistem tarafından yönetilen kimlikle hedef kaynak grubunda örnek oluşturun.

az dt create -n {instance_name} -g {resouce_group} --assign-identity

Sistem tarafından yönetilen bir kimlikle hedef kaynak grubunda örnek oluşturun ve ardından kimliği Katkıda Bulunan rolüyle bir veya daha fazla kapsama (boşlukla ayrılmış) atayın.

az dt create -n {instance_name} -g {resouce_group} --assign-identity --scopes "/subscriptions/a12345ea-bb21-994d-2263-c716348e32a1/resourceGroups/ProResourceGroup/providers/Microsoft.EventHub/namespaces/myEventHubNamespace/eventhubs/myEventHub" "/subscriptions/a12345ea-bb21-994d-2263-c716348e32a1/resourceGroups/ProResourceGroup/providers/Microsoft.ServiceBus/namespaces/myServiceBusNamespace/topics/myTopic"

Sistem tarafından yönetilen bir kimlikle hedef kaynak grubunda örnek oluşturun, ardından kimliği özel bir belirtilen role sahip bir veya daha fazla kapsama atayın.

az dt create -n {instance_name} -g {resouce_group} --assign-identity --scopes "/subscriptions/a12345ea-bb21-994d-2263-c716348e32a1/resourceGroups/ProResourceGroup/providers/Microsoft.EventHub/namespaces/myEventHubNamespace/eventhubs/myEventHub" "/subscriptions/a12345ea-bb21-994d-2263-c716348e32a1/resourceGroups/ProResourceGroup/providers/Microsoft.ServiceBus/namespaces/myServiceBusNamespace/topics/myTopic" --role MyCustomRole

Sistem tarafından yönetilen kimliği etkinleştirmek için hedef kaynak grubundaki bir örneği güncelleştirin.

az dt create -n {instance_name} -g {resouce_group} --assign-identity

Sistem tarafından yönetilen kimliği devre dışı bırakmak için hedef kaynak grubundaki bir örneği güncelleştirin.

az dt create -n {instance_name} -g {resouce_group} --assign-identity false

Hedef kaynak grubundaki bir örneği yeni etiket değerleriyle güncelleştirin ve genel ağ erişimini devre dışı bırakın.

az dt create -n {instance_name} -g {resouce_group} --tags env=prod --public-network-access Disabled

Gerekli Parametreler

--dt-name --dtn -n

Digital Twins örneği adı.

--resource-group -g

Digital Twins örneği kaynak grubu. varsayılan grubu kullanarak az configure --defaults group=<name>yapılandırabilirsiniz.

İsteğe Bağlı Parametreler

--assign-identity

Digital Twins örneğine sistem tarafından oluşturulan bir kimlik atayın.

kabul edilen değerler: false, true
--location -l

Digital Twins örneği konumu. Konum sağlanmazsa kaynak grubu konumu kullanılır. varsayılan konumu kullanarak az configure --defaults location=<name>yapılandırabilirsiniz.

--no-wait

Uzun süre çalışan işlemin bitmesini beklemeyin.

--pna --public-network-access

Digital Twins örneğine genel bir ağdan erişilip erişilebileceğini belirler.

kabul edilen değerler: Disabled, Enabled
varsayılan değer: Enabled
--role

Sistem tarafından atanan kimliğin sahip olacağı rol adı veya kimlik.

varsayılan değer: Contributor
--scopes

Sistem tarafından atanan kimliğin erişebileceği boşlukla ayrılmış kapsamlar. --no-wait ile kullanılamaz.

--tags

Digital Twins örnek etiketleri. Anahtar-değer çiftlerindeki özellik paketi şu biçimdedir: a=b c=d.

az dt delete

Var olan bir Digital Twins örneğini silin.

az dt delete --dt-name
             [--no-wait]
             [--resource-group]
             [--yes]

Örnekler

Onay istemiyle rastgele bir örneği engelleme biçiminde silin.

az dt delete -n {instance_name}

Engelleme veya istem olmadan rastgele bir örneği silin.

az dt delete -n {instance_name} -y --no-wait

Gerekli Parametreler

--dt-name --dtn -n

Digital Twins örneği adı.

İsteğe Bağlı Parametreler

--no-wait

Uzun süre çalışan işlemin bitmesini beklemeyin.

--resource-group -g

Digital Twins örneği kaynak grubu. varsayılan grubu kullanarak az configure --defaults group=<name>yapılandırabilirsiniz.

--yes -y

Onay istemde bulunmayın.

az dt list

Digital Twins örneklerinin koleksiyonunu aboneliğe veya kaynak grubuna göre listeleyin.

az dt list [--resource-group]

Örnekler

Geçerli abonelikteki tüm örnekleri listeleyin.

az dt list

Hedef kaynak grubundaki tüm örnekleri ve çıktıyı tablo biçiminde listeleyin.

az dt list -g {resource_group} --output table

Abonelikteki bir koşulu karşılayan tüm örnekleri listeleyin.

az dt list --query "[?contains(name, 'Production')]"

Koşulu karşılayan örnekleri sayma.

az dt list --query "length([?contains(name, 'Production')])"

İsteğe Bağlı Parametreler

--resource-group -g

Digital Twins örneği kaynak grubu. varsayılan grubu kullanarak az configure --defaults group=<name>yapılandırabilirsiniz.

az dt reset

İlişkili varlıkları silerek mevcut Digital Twins örneğini sıfırlayın. Şu anda yalnızca modelleri ve ikizleri silmeyi desteklemektedir.

az dt reset --dt-name
            [--resource-group]
            [--yes]

Örnekler

Digital Twins örneğinin tüm varlıklarını sıfırlayın.

az dt reset -n {instance_name}

Gerekli Parametreler

--dt-name --dtn -n

Digital Twins örneği adı.

İsteğe Bağlı Parametreler

--resource-group -g

Digital Twins örneği kaynak grubu. varsayılan grubu kullanarak az configure --defaults group=<name>yapılandırabilirsiniz.

--yes -y

Onay istemde bulunmayın.

az dt show

Mevcut bir Digital Twins örneğini gösterme.

az dt show --dt-name
           [--resource-group]

Örnekler

Örneği gösterme.

az dt show -n {instance_name}

Bir örneği gösterme ve belirli özellikleri yansıtma.

az dt show -n {instance_name} --query "{Endpoint:hostName, Location:location}"

Gerekli Parametreler

--dt-name --dtn -n

Digital Twins örneği adı.

İsteğe Bağlı Parametreler

--resource-group -g

Digital Twins örneği kaynak grubu. varsayılan grubu kullanarak az configure --defaults group=<name>yapılandırabilirsiniz.

az dt wait

Digital Twins örneğindeki bir işlem tamamlanana kadar bekleyin.

az dt wait --dt-name
           [--created]
           [--custom]
           [--deleted]
           [--exists]
           [--interval]
           [--resource-group]
           [--timeout]

Örnekler

Rastgele bir örnek oluşturulana kadar bekleyin.

az dt wait -n {instance_name} --created

Var olan bir örnek silinene kadar bekleyin.

az dt wait -n {instance_name} --deleted

Mevcut örneğin publicNetworkAccess özelliği Etkin olarak ayarlanana kadar bekleyin

az dt wait -n {instance_name} --custom "publicNetworkAccess=='Enabled'"

Gerekli Parametreler

--dt-name --dtn -n

Digital Twins örneği adı.

İsteğe Bağlı Parametreler

--created

'provisioningState' ile 'Succeeded' konumunda oluşturulana kadar bekleyin.

--custom

Koşul özel bir JMESPath sorgusunu karşılayana kadar bekleyin. Örneğin provisioningState!='InProgress', instanceView.statuses[?code=='PowerState/running'].

--deleted

Silinene kadar bekleyin.

--exists

Kaynak var olana kadar bekleyin.

--interval

Saniye cinsinden yoklama aralığı.

varsayılan değer: 30
--resource-group -g

Digital Twins örneği kaynak grubu. varsayılan grubu kullanarak az configure --defaults group=<name>yapılandırabilirsiniz.

--timeout

Saniye cinsinden en fazla bekleme.

varsayılan değer: 3600